The Disney Experiences (DX) Technology team combines custom technology solutions with creativity to produce robust applications that enhance all aspects of the guest experience. From one of the most sophisticated hotel reservation systems in the world to Disney Cruise Line shipboard systems, Disney Vacation Club member services, ticketing, PhotoPass, and even inventory applications to ensure we have the right number of Cast costumes. DX Technology seeks forward-thinking team members who are passionate about delivering a quality product and enjoy working closely with business partners on both strategic and tactical challenges.

The Senior Software Engineer applies practical knowledge of development and engineering to conceive, design, develop, test, and implement software fixes, enhancements, components, and/or new software systems and applications of moderate to high complexity. The Senior Software Engineer owns design and development and drives component development through his/her own’ and subordinate engineers’ work. The Senior Engineer provides technical guidance and acts as a point of escalation and technical expert. The Senior Software Engineer designs and develops highly scalable software systems and applications.

Primary Responsibilities:

Owns the design and development of software fixes, enhancements, components, and/or new software systems and applications.

Drives development of components through own and subordinate engineers' work.

Develops technical solutions that meet specifications and that impact future developments.

Executes assigned component level software development projects and major fixes using new or existing technologies.

Develops specifications for assigned components, projects or fixes.

Reviews or writes code.

Leads programming, testing and debugging of applications or fixes to existing applications.

Creates protocols, documentation and tools for installation and maintenance.

Participates in setting the architectural direction for software development projects.

Designs specific components for assigned projects, developing specifications for each.

Designs, develops, manages, creates and maintains technical components and templates.

Able to code against full-stack technology stack and lead end-to-end troubleshooting.

Interacts and coordinates deliverables with other technical groups in the organization.

Executes assigned component level projects using new or existing technologies

Designs and develops specifications for assigned projects

Reviews or troubleshoots and performs testing.

Participates in conceiving and setting the architectural direction for development projects.

Designs the component tasks of assigned projects, developing specifications for each

Serves as a high level technical resource and “go-to” person for less experienced developers, providing technical guidance and oversight.

Leads team members in problem analysis and issue resolution.

Recommends improvements to processes, technology, and interfaces that improve the effectiveness of the team.

The hiring range for this position in California is $$138,900 - $186,200 per year and in Washington is $145,400 - $195,000per year.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ate’s ge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ors. A bonus and/or long-term incentive units may be provided as part of the compensation package, in addition to the full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ered.
